This standard specifies the product classification, technical requirements, test methods, inspection rules, marking, packaging, transportation and storage of rigid polyvinyl chloride adhesive socket pipe fittings made of polyvinyl chloride resin as the main raw material and added with necessary additives through injection molding. The pipe fittings specified in this standard are used in conjunction with the pipes specified in GB 5836.1-92. This standard applies to pipe fittings for drainage in civil buildings. Under the condition of considering the chemical resistance and temperature resistance of the material, it can also be used for industrial drainage pipe fittings. GB/T 5836.2—92 Figure 3 90° elbow Nominal diameter d. 50×50 75×75 90×90 110×50 110×75 110×110 125×125 160×160 Z 2min GB/T 5836. 2--92 Figure 490° Tee along the water Ls3min Nominal diameter d. 50×50 75×50 75×75 90×50 90×90 110x50 110×75 110×110 125×50||t t||125×75 125×110 125×125 160×75 160×90 160×110 160×125 160×160 GB/T 5836.2—92 545° oblique tee Z amin nominal diameter d. 110×50 110×75 GB/T 5836.2— Figure 6 Bottle-type tee nominal diameter d. 75×75 90×90 110×50 110×75 110x110 125×125 160×160 GB/T 5836.2--92 Figure 7 Straight cross nominal diameter d. 50×50 75×50 75×75 90×50 90×90 110×50 110×75 110×110 125×50||t t||125×75 125×110 125×125 160×75 160×90 160×110 160×125 160×160 GB/T 5836.2--92 Figure 8 Oblique cross Nominal diameter d. 50×50 75×75 90×90 110×50 110x75 110x110 125×125 160×160 ZAamin GB/T 5836.2-92 Figure 9 Right angle cross GB/T 5836.2-92 Nominal diameter d. 50×40 Picture 10 reducer 75×50 90×75 110x50 110×75 110×90 125×50 125 Nominal diameter d. 4 Technical requirements GB/T 5836.2-92 Figure 11 Pipe clamp 4.1 Color Pipe fittings are generally gray, and other colors can be agreed upon by both the supplier and the buyer. 4.2 Appearance The inner and outer walls of the pipe fittings should be smooth and flat. No bubbles, cracks, obvious marks, depressions, uneven color, or decomposition discoloration lines are allowed. The pipe fittings should be complete and without defects, and the gates and overflows should be repaired and flat. 4.3 Specification size deviation 4.3.1 The average inner diameter and the depth of the socket in the middle of the pipe fitting should comply with the provisions of Figure 1 and Table 1. 4.3.2 The wall thickness of the pipe fitting should be greater than or equal to the wall thickness of the pipe of the same specification specified in GB5836.1. 4.4 The physical and mechanical properties of the pipe fittings should comply with the provisions of Table 12.
